Just some of the many problems stem cells could cure include: Congestive heart failure, stroke damage, replacement joints, retinal degenerations, hearing loss, cerebral palsy, bone diseases, leukemia, blood and vessels, kidney failure, diabetes, Parkinson’s disease, Lou Gehrigs disease and many other neurological disorders. As well as making antibody cells and building new organs to be implanted in replacement of damaged ones. In order to do more research and make the cells that would cure all these disorders and diseases, they would have to grow embryos in a laboratory setting. This process would start out by in vitro fertilization in a petri dish and begin to grow into stem cells. Much more research has to be done before actually implementing this process of implantation and the only way to get enough cells to research is through embryos. On the other hand, this creates a problem for most of the same people who disagree with abortion.
